Bhattiguda - Usur, Bijapur

Bhattiguda is a village situated in the Usur tehsil of Bijapur district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 23 km from the tehsil headquarters in Usur and around 60 km from the district headquarters in Bijapur. Engpalli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bhattiguda village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hattiguda is 450859. The village covers a total geographical area of 809.6 hectares and falls under the 494447 pincode. Jagdalpur is the nearest town, located about 215 km away.

Bhattiguda village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bijapur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bastar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Bhattiguda

According to the 2011 Census, Bhattiguda village had a total population of 370 people, including 188 males and 182 females, living in 75 households. The sex ratio was 968 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 27.61%, with male literacy at 39.52% and female literacy at 15.09%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 369.

Transport and Connectivity of Bhattiguda

Bhattiguda is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the village.

The road distance from Jagdalpur to Bhattiguda is about 215 km, with a usual travel time of around ~6.1 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Bijapur to Bhattiguda is about 60 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
